Tobacco Pouch
37948
From: Great Plains (Plain)
Curatorial Section: American
Object Number | 37948 |
Current Location | Collections Storage |
Culture | Blackfeet |
Provenience | Great Plains (Plain) |
Culture Area | Great Plains Culture Area |
Section | American |
Materials | Buckskin | Glass |
Technique | Beaded |
Description | Smoked leather with a floral beaded design on white ground. Long fringe at one end with cylindrical purple beads. Green beads line the edges of the pouch, including the four rounded flaps at the opening. |
Length | 75 cm |
Width | 24 cm |
Credit Line | Purchased from Thomas B. Donaldson; subscription of John Wanamaker, 1901 |
